Output cd381a1a8fd1b8ca08593201fbbf80b7c7a1424ae17574fe9018e87bda45670e:8

value
3418762
script pubkey
OP_0 OP_PUSHBYTES_20 1b56061063ad7bca23731893e39726aaa3e29a3a
address
bc1qrdtqvyrr44au5gmnrzf789ex42379x36y3uyjq
transaction
cd381a1a8fd1b8ca08593201fbbf80b7c7a1424ae17574fe9018e87bda45670e
confirmations
109850
spent
true